Art Therapy therapists in Dovercourt-Wallace Emerson-Junction, ON Statistics
Art Therapy therapists in Dovercourt-Wallace Emerson-Junction, ON average 13 years of experience and charge around $178 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(82%), Depression (82%), and Loss or Grief (78%).
